Better late than never! (for this podcast and the set at hand!) Nick and Zak split this one up a little differently, first the Non-Acron Stamped legends and main deck cards, THEN the Acorn cards. We highly recommend you stay for the acorn section, because (no spoilers) the eternal-legal cards might leave you with a negative taste in your mouth if you're anything like the two hosts. And Nick did some major diving into cards for the goofs, so stay tuned, and let us know what cards you liked, what you wished was or wasn't legal, or just your feelings about the set as a whole!
